Output e554155300a6ccc6276e7ea7cf7d19fe1f64fd0d61ff9dcd52d225a6be85ed40:0

value
685000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704b7704605c5d90675a0c79302ccbce3f7f4472 OP_EQUAL
address
MJ8vKJt543EuwQPDnh9Vww3n4rw7N8xU72
transaction
e554155300a6ccc6276e7ea7cf7d19fe1f64fd0d61ff9dcd52d225a6be85ed40
spent
true